To standardize and enhance the evaluation of underground assets, the National Association of Sewer Service Companies (NASSCO) offers specialized certification programs: the Pipeline Assessment Certification Program (PACP™), Lateral Assessment Certification Program (LACP™), and Manhole Assessment Certification Program (MACP™). These programs provide consistent methodologies for assessing the condition of pipelines, laterals, and manholes, respectively. By implementing these standardized assessment techniques, municipalities and utility companies can accurately identify and prioritize areas requiring maintenance or rehabilitation, thereby optimizing resource allocation and extending the lifespan of their infrastructure assets.

NASSCO's certification programs equip professionals with the skills to conduct thorough and uniform inspections, facilitating the creation of comprehensive databases that inform data-driven decision-making. This approach not only aids in preventing unexpected failures but also supports strategic planning for infrastructure upgrades. By integrating NASSCO-certified assessments into their maintenance protocols, organizations can achieve more efficient management of underground infrastructure, ultimately leading to significant cost savings and improved system reliability.

Pipeline Assessment Certificaton Program (PACP)

The Pipeline Assessment Certification Program (PACP) standardizes sewer pipe inspection coding, providing a consistent language for wastewater professionals to ensure efficient maintenance and management.

Lateral Assessment Certificaton Program (LACP)

The Lateral Assessment Certification Program (LACP) standardizes lateral pipe inspection coding, providing a consistent language for wastewater professionals to ensure efficient maintenance and management.

Manhole Assessment Certificaton Program (MACP)

The Manhole Assessment Certification Program (MACP) standardizes manhole inspection coding, providing a consistent language for wastewater professionals to ensure efficient maintenance and management.
